Creekside stands at 14051 Norwich Lane in Orland Park. It rises three stories and contains 12 condominium units. The building completed construction in 1997. This low-rise building adds a residential touch to the area. Nearby, Wolf Road and 143rd Street create easy access routes.
Unit sizes range from 1,750 to 1,850 square feet. Each unit includes 2 bedrooms, making them suitable for small families or roommates. Prices for the units fall between $240,000 and $275,000. The average closed price sits at $275,000, while the average price per square foot is $199. Units tend to spend about 112 days on the market.
Amenities support a comfortable lifestyle. Residents can enjoy a park area, spa, and hot tub right at home. An elevator provides easy access to all floors. Nearby public schools include Music Way and others in the Orland Park School District, adding value for families with children.
Dining options like Palermo's Restaurant & Pizzeria lie close by. This location provides a blend of residential charm and community access. The area is also near Tampier Lake, an appealing spot for enjoying nature.

This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 19.85% are children aged 0–14, 14.58% are young adults between 15–29, 19.26% are adults aged 30–44, 24.92% are in the 45–59 range and 21.39% are seniors aged 60 and above.
Commuting options are also varying where 85.85% of residents relying on driving, while others prefer public transit around 5.04%, walking around 0.76%, biking around 0.15%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ines.
Most homes in the area are with 89.44% of units owner occupied and 10.56% are rented.
The neighborhood offers different household types. About 33.21% are single family homes and 10.9% are multi family units. Around 26.9% are single-person households, while 73.1%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als.
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 28.41%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 21.69% have high school or college education. Another 13.02% hold diplomas while 15.21%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 21.68% with other types of qualifications.
